Overview

POSCO is an integrated steel producer in Korea. The Company operates in four segments: steel, engineering and construction, trading, and others. The steel segment includes production of steel products and sale of such products. The engineering and construction segment includes planning, designing and construction of industrial plants, civil engineering projects and commercial and residential buildings, both in Korea and overseas. The trading segment consists of exporting and importing a range of steel products that are both obtained from and supplied to POSCO, as well as between other suppliers and purchasers in Korea and overseas. The others segment includes power generation, liquefied natural gas production, network and system integration, logistics and magnesium coil and sheet production. On October 9, 2009, the Company established a wholly owned subsidiary, POSCO Maharashtra Steel Private Limited. In November 2009, the Company acquired a 65% stake in PT. Motta Resources Indonesia.

Quick Financial Synopsis

BRIEF: For the fiscal year ended 31 December 2008, POSCO's total revenues increased 32% to W41.743T. Net income increased 23% to W4.379T. Revenues reflect an increased demand for steel segment. Net income was partially offset by higher non-operating expense such as loss on foreign exchange transaction, interest expenses, higher loss on reduction of investment assets and loss on valuation of derivatives.
